Output 7678576c1406b184081304aae5ddde3dc71b19fd4bb0604d1c8f8eaf175f2d02:9

value
323588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 741863c93dae2dbac1a6e5eb193aba82cc9b0a65 OP_EQUAL
address
3CGsXRoGChQ7ycfufg5swmXGnpH7Vvi7i1
transaction
7678576c1406b184081304aae5ddde3dc71b19fd4bb0604d1c8f8eaf175f2d02
spent
true